Slovak

[edit]

Etymology

[edit]

Inherited from Proto-Slavic *koprъ.

Pronunciation

[edit]
  • IPA(key): /ku̯ɔpɔr/, [ˈku̯ɔpɔr]
  • Rhymes: -u̯ɔpɔr
  • Hyphenation: kô‧por

Noun

[edit]

kôpor m inan (genitive singular kôpru, declension pattern of dub)

  1. dill (herb)

Declension

[edit]
Declension of kôpor
singulare tantum
nominative kôpor
genitive kôpru
dative kôpru
accusative kôpor
locative kôpri
instrumental kôprom
